✦ Synopsis
In the title compound, [Cd(C 11 H 9 ClN 3 O 2 ) 2 ]Á4H 2 O, the Cd II atom is coordinated by four N atoms and two O atoms from two picolinate ligands in a distorted octahedral geometry. In the crystal structure, molecules are linked together by intermolecular O-HÁ Á ÁO hydrogen bonds. Related literature For related literature, see: Bhatia et al. (1981); Costamagna et al. (1992).
Experimental Crystal data [Cd(C 11 H 9 ClN 3 O 2 ) 2 ]Á4H 2 O M r = 685.79 Triclinic, P1 a = 10.1790 (10) A b = 11.4140 (14) A c = 13.4240 (18) A = 114.745 (3) = 102.249 (2) = 96.4280 (10) V = 1348.3 (3) A ˚3 Z = 2 Mo K radiation = 1.07 mm À1 T = 298 (2) K 0.51 Â 0.50 Â 0.48 mm Data collection Bruker SMART CCD area-detector diffractometer Absorption correction: multi-scan (SADABS; Sheldrick, 1996) T min = 0.613, T max = 0.629 6989 measured reflections 4645 independent reflections 3752 reflections with I > 2(I) R int = 0.020 Refinement R[F 2 > 2(F 2 )] = 0.037 wR(F 2 ) = 0.101 S = 1.05 4645 reflections
